What Is OneForma?
OneForma is a global crowdsourcing and AI enablement platform operated by Pactera EDGE, a well-established company specialising in AI data solutions and global localisation. Launched in 2019, OneForma has grown to serve over 1.8 million contributors in 230+ markets and supports work in more than 150 languages.
Unlike simple micro-task platforms such as Hive Micro or Clickworker, OneForma sits closer to the professional end of the spectrum. It offers a mix of short tasks and longer-term project-based work, which means higher pay — but also a more competitive application process. The platform primarily helps businesses build and improve AI systems by collecting human-labelled data, evaluating AI outputs, and performing language-related work.
Types of OneForma Jobs Kenya Workers Can Access
- Data collection — Submit photos, videos, or audio recordings to specified criteria for AI training datasets
- Data annotation and labelling — Tag, classify, and label images, text, or audio to train machine learning models
- Transcription — Convert audio or video recordings into accurate written text
- Translation — Translate content between languages; multiple Kenyan and African languages are listed
- Internet judging (UHRS) — Rate and evaluate web content, search results, and digital data to improve algorithms for major tech companies
- Content evaluation — Review and score AI-generated text or chatbot responses for accuracy and quality
- App and website testing — Test digital products for usability and functionality
- Part-time and full-time career roles — For highly qualified contributors, OneForma lists longer-term paid positions
Note on UHRS: Internet judging through OneForma gives you access to UHRS (Universal Human Relevance System) — a Microsoft-powered judging platform used by major tech companies. UHRS jobs often pay more per hour than standard micro-tasks and are highly valued by experienced crowd-workers.
Is OneForma Available in Kenya?
Yes. OneForma is open to workers worldwide including Kenya, and Kenyan users are confirmed to actively work and get paid on the platform. The sign-up process works from Kenya, and there are no country-level blocks.
However, there is an important nuance: some jobs on OneForma are location-restricted. Certain projects — particularly those requiring native speakers of specific languages or residents of particular countries — will not be visible or available to you based on your profile. This is standard on all professional AI data platforms and is not a sign that Kenya is excluded; it simply means job availability varies by project.
For Kenyans, the best opportunities tend to be in:
- English-language tasks — Kenya has a large English-speaking population, making English-based data annotation, transcription, and internet judging accessible
- Swahili and other local language projects — OneForma actively sources African language data for AI training, meaning Swahili, Kikuyu, Luo, and other Kenyan language speakers have unique advantages
- Data collection projects — Photo and video collection tasks are typically open globally

How to Get Started on OneForma in Kenya (Step-by-Step)
Getting started requires a bit more setup than simpler platforms, but it is worth the effort because the pay is higher. Follow these steps carefully:
- Create your account — Go to oneforma.com and click Join. Enter your full name, email address, country (Kenya), city, and a strong password. Registration is completely free.
- Verify your email — Check your inbox for a verification link and click it. Your account will not be fully active until this is done.
- Complete your profile in full — This step is critical. Fill in your native language(s), secondary languages, areas of expertise, educational background, and work preferences. The more complete your profile, the more job matches you will receive.
- Earn certifications — OneForma offers certification tests for skills such as transcription accuracy, native language competency, and data annotation. Complete as many as you qualify for. Certifications significantly increase your chances of being approved for better-paying projects.
- Submit your W-8BEN form — Non-US workers are required to complete a W-8BEN tax form (a standard international tax declaration) before receiving payments. You can submit this within your account settings. Do not skip this — it is mandatory for payout eligibility.
- Set up your payment method — Go to your profile settings and connect either a verified PayPal account or a Payoneer account as your withdrawal method. Do this early so you are ready when your first payment is due. Note: PayPal payments from OneForma are capped at $300 per year; beyond that limit you must switch to Payoneer or Tipalti.
- Browse and apply for jobs — From your dashboard, click Jobs to see the current listings. Jobs are organised by category. Read each description carefully and apply for those that match your skills and language profile.
- Wait for approval — Some jobs approve contributors quickly; others take days or weeks depending on project needs. There is no guarantee of immediate work. Be patient and keep checking for new listings.
- Complete assigned work carefully — Once approved for a project, follow all guidelines precisely. Quality is monitored closely. Poor performance can result in removal from a project and affect your ability to be approved for others.
- Get paid on the 10th and 25th of each month — OneForma pays twice monthly. Your earnings accumulated between payout cycles are sent to your PayPal or Payoneer on those dates, provided you have reached the $10 minimum threshold.

OneForma Pay Kenya: How Much Can You Earn?
OneForma is generally considered to pay better than most micro-task platforms — and this is backed by user reviews. The trade-off is that work is not always available and requires an application process.
Pay Rates by Job Type
| Job Type | Typical Pay Rate |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Data collection (photos/video) | $15 – $70 per project | Project-based; can earn $50+ in one session |
| Transcription | $0.03 – $0.05 per word | Language-dependent; good for fast typists |
| Translation | $0.03 – $0.10 per word | Higher for rare languages |
| Internet judging (UHRS) | $3 – $8 per hour | Most consistent hourly pay on the platform |
| Data annotation/labelling | $3 – $10 per hour | Varies by complexity |
| Content evaluation | $3 – $12 per hour | AI output review tasks |
| App/website testing | $5 – $15 per test | Varies by project scope |
Realistic Monthly Earning Estimates
| Activity Level | Time Per Week | Est. Monthly Earnings (USD) | Est. Monthly Earnings (KES)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Occasional (applying only, little work) | 1–3 hrs | $5 – $15 | KES 650 – KES 1,950 |
| Regular (1–2 active projects) | 5–10 hrs | $20 – $60 | KES 2,600 – KES 7,800 |
| Active (UHRS + projects) | 10–20 hrs | $60 – $150 | KES 7,800 – KES 19,500 |
| Full-time contributor | 30–40 hrs | $150 – $400+ | KES 19,500 – KES 52,000+ |
KES figures are approximate at KES 130 per USD. Earnings depend heavily on which projects you qualify for and project availability at any given time.
One experienced community reviewer reported earning $50 from a single photo submission project and another $70 from a video collection project — figures that are significantly higher than what typical micro-task platforms offer. However, these are not daily opportunities; they are project windows that open and close.
⚠️ Income Reality Check: Full-time income figures are possible but not guaranteed. Work availability fluctuates based on client project cycles. Many Kenyan contributors earn a useful side income of KES 5,000 to KES 15,000 per month rather than a replacement salary. Treat it as serious supplemental income, not a guaranteed monthly salary.
OneForma Pay Kenya: How to Withdraw Your Earnings

OneForma processes payouts twice per month, on the 10th and 25th of each month. You must have a minimum balance of $10 in your account to receive a payment on those dates.
Payment Methods Available to Kenyan Users
| Method | Minimum Balance | Payout Schedule | Annual Limit | Available in Kenya |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| PayPal | $10 | 10th & 25th monthly | $300/year | Yes |
| Payoneer | $10 | 10th & 25th monthly | No limit | Yes |
| Tipalti | $10 | 10th & 25th monthly | No limit | Yes |
Important: PayPal payments from OneForma are capped at $300 per year. If you are a high earner, set up Payoneer or Tipalti from the start to avoid any payout interruptions when you reach that ceiling.
How to Get OneForma Earnings to M-Pesa in 2026
Route 1 — PayPal to M-Pesa directly (Recommended for smaller amounts):
- Make sure your PayPal account is verified and linked to your Kenyan phone number.
- Once your OneForma earnings land in PayPal, open the M-Pesa app on your phone.
- Go to Global Payments > PayPal.
- Tap Withdraw Funds, enter the amount, and confirm.
- Funds typically arrive in your M-Pesa wallet within minutes.
Note: Since August 2025, the PayPal–M-Pesa integration operates directly through the M-Pesa Super App (Safaricom’s updated system), replacing the previous Thunes-powered service. The exchange rate includes approximately a 3% margin on conversions.
Route 2 — PayPal to MiniPay to M-Pesa (Recommended for better exchange rates):
- Download the MiniPay app and complete KYC verification to get a virtual US bank account.
- In PayPal, withdraw to your MiniPay US account (treated as a US bank — typically $0 withdrawal fee).
- From MiniPay, withdraw to M-Pesa at a more competitive exchange rate.
This route is used by experienced Kenyan freelancers who want to avoid PayPal’s less favourable KES conversion rate — especially on larger withdrawals.
Route 3 — Payoneer to Kenyan Bank to M-Pesa:
- Set up a free Payoneer account and link it to OneForma.
- Request withdrawal from Payoneer to your Kenyan bank (Equity, KCB, Co-op Bank, etc.).
- Use your bank’s mobile app to transfer to M-Pesa.
Pros and Cons of OneForma for Kenyan Users
✅ Pros
- Higher pay than most micro-task platforms — data collection projects can pay $50+ in a single session
- Access to UHRS internet judging, one of the most consistent and reliable paid task types
- Works in 150+ languages — Swahili and other Kenyan languages open up exclusive project opportunities
- Twice-monthly automatic payments with a low $10 threshold
- Legitimate, established platform backed by Pactera EDGE, a major global company
- Project-based work means some jobs offer sustained income over weeks or months
- Free to join, no investment required
- Mobile app available for completing tasks on the go
❌ Cons
- Work is not always immediately available — approval times can take days or weeks
- PayPal payments capped at $300/year (must switch to Payoneer for higher earners)
- Requires completing a W-8BEN tax form before getting paid
- More competitive than basic micro-task sites — not every application is approved
- Customer support is slow, according to multiple reviews
- Income is inconsistent and project-dependent
- Some high-paying projects require specialised skills or language certifications
Tips to Maximise Your Earnings on OneForma Kenya
- Complete every available certification. Certified contributors are prioritised for project approvals. Even if a certification seems hard, attempt it — passing it unlocks higher-paying jobs.
- List all your languages in your profile. If you speak Swahili, Kikuyu, Luo, or any other Kenyan language in addition to English, list all of them. African language data is actively in demand for AI projects and can give you access to unique projects other contributors cannot apply for.
- Apply for UHRS internet judging early. Internet judging via UHRS tends to offer the most consistent hourly pay on the platform. Getting approved for UHRS access is one of the best outcomes of joining OneForma.
- Set up Payoneer from day one. Even if you start with PayPal, set up Payoneer in parallel so you are not interrupted when you hit the $300 PayPal annual limit.
- Check for new job listings daily. Data collection and annotation projects can fill up quickly. Logging in every morning (Kenya time) increases your chances of being early in the application queue.
- Be thorough in job applications. Unlike basic task platforms, OneForma projects involve a review process. Submitting a detailed, accurate application is worth the extra effort.
- Keep your submission quality high. Once you are on a project, maintain consistent quality. Long-term projects that run for weeks or months are far more valuable than short one-off tasks. Do not rush work just to increase volume.
- Use the referral programme. OneForma has a referral scheme — share your invite link. While the exact commission structure is not fully detailed on the platform, referring active workers can generate additional passive income.
Common Mistakes to Avoid on OneForma
- Skipping the W-8BEN form. This is a tax requirement for non-US workers. Without it, your payments will be held. Complete it during your first login session.
- Leaving your profile incomplete. OneForma’s job-matching system uses your profile to suggest suitable projects. An empty profile means fewer (or no) job matches.
- Ignoring certifications. Many beginners skip certification tests because they seem like extra work. This is a mistake — certifications are the primary way to unlock better-paying jobs.
- Applying only to high-paying jobs and ignoring smaller ones. Building a track record with smaller projects makes you more likely to be approved for larger, better-paid ones.
- Creating multiple accounts. Strictly prohibited. Duplicate accounts result in a permanent ban.
- Using a VPN. VPN use violates OneForma’s terms of service and can result in account suspension.
- Expecting immediate work. OneForma is not a tap-and-earn platform. Expect a setup and approval period of one to several weeks before consistent work arrives.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. Is OneForma legit and safe for Kenyan users?
Yes. OneForma is a legitimate platform operated by Pactera EDGE, a well-established global company. It has paid contributors in many countries including Kenya, and has a verified presence on major review platforms like Capterra and Glassdoor. Multiple independent reviewers confirm receiving real payments. As with any online platform, use your personal email, never pay to join, and be cautious of unofficial “OneForma agents” on social media.
2. What types of OneForma AI jobs are available to Kenyan workers?
Kenyan workers can access data collection, data annotation, transcription, translation (including Swahili and other local languages), internet judging via UHRS, content evaluation, and app testing. The availability of specific OneForma AI jobs Kenya workers see depends on your profile, languages, certifications, and which projects are currently active.
3. How does OneForma pay Kenyan workers, and can I receive money via M-Pesa?
OneForma pays via PayPal (up to $300/year) or Payoneer (no annual limit). There is also a Tipalti option. M-Pesa is not a direct payout method, but Kenyan workers can receive their PayPal earnings to M-Pesa using the direct PayPal–M-Pesa integration inside the M-Pesa Super App, or via Payoneer to a Kenyan bank account, then to M-Pesa through mobile banking.
4. What is the minimum payout threshold on OneForma?
The minimum withdrawal amount is $10 for both PayPal and Payoneer. Payouts are processed automatically on the 10th and 25th of each month — no manual withdrawal request is needed once your balance reaches $10.
5. How long does it take to get approved for jobs on OneForma?
Approval times vary. Some projects approve new contributors within a day or two; others may take one to three weeks depending on how many applicants the project manager is reviewing. There is no guaranteed timeframe. Completing certifications and having a detailed profile speeds up the process.
6. Does OneForma require any special skills for Kenyan workers?
Not necessarily — many entry-level data collection and annotation tasks require no prior experience, just attention to detail and the ability to follow instructions in English. Higher-paying tasks such as transcription, translation, and internet judging benefit from language skills, fast typing, or familiarity with digital tools. Native speakers of Swahili or other Kenyan languages have a particular advantage for language-specific AI projects.
7. Is OneForma worth it for Kenyans compared to other platforms in 2026?
Yes — especially if you qualify for UHRS internet judging or language-specific projects. OneForma generally pays more per hour than platforms like ySense or Hive Micro. The main challenges are the approval wait time and inconsistent project availability. For the best results, use OneForma alongside one or two other platforms so you always have income sources during slow periods.
